But prior to doing this, you have to initially think of the right scent for you. Here is a list on how you can discover out the smell that matches your activities and character.

1.    What components do you desire your scent to have?

Do you want your cologne or perfume to have natural ingredients? Do you want indulging components of your perfume? Always check the ingredients and substance included in making your cologne or perfume.

2.    What is the price of your perfume?

What is the price that is suitable for you? Do you desire luxurious and classy colognes or perfumes? Is it enough for you to buy economical imitations or will you go for the signature perfumes which are authentic?

3.    What do you desire? A subtle or a strong aroma?

Do you like a strong lingering aroma? Or do you prefer light scents for the nose to smell? The strength of the smell depends whether it is irritating for you to smell strong scents.

4.    What are your skin consistency, skin tone, and dampness?

There are some perfumes that can make the skin dry. And there are some that cannot last long in a skin that always sweat. Know your parameters before you buy the perfume that you want. It may work with your nose but not with your skin.
